Примеры ответов Нейро на вопросы из разных сфер
Главная / Наука и образование / В чем отличие глобальных переменных от локальных в Linux?
Вопрос для Нейро
12 февраля
В чем отличие глобальных переменных от локальных в Linux?
Нейро
На основе 5 источников

Отличие глобальных переменных от локальных в Linux заключается в области видимости:

  • Глобальные переменные видны из сеанса оболочки и из любых порождённых дочерних подоболочек. 1 Любая пользовательская или системная программа может получить доступ к их значению. 3
  • Локальные переменные доступны только в оболочке, которая их создаёт. 1 Их можно использовать как параметр команды, но запущенная программа не сможет получить к ним доступ напрямую. 3

Изначально любая переменная создаётся как локальная, но её можно сделать глобальной с помощью команды export. 3

Также глобальные переменные обычно написаны прописными буквами, а локальные — строчными. 2 Это не обязательно, но желательно, чтобы не путать и случайно не переопределить важную системную переменную. 2

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Нейро
Thu Mar 20 2025 18:24:43 GMT+0300 (Moscow Standard Time)